Crayon Corner receives a QRS 4-Star Rating

Last fall, Crayon Corner Learning Center, Gladbrook, earned a 4-Star Rating from Iowa’s Quality Rating System (QRS). CCLC is the only licensed Tama County daycare center that holds a 4-star rating. QRS is a voluntary program, overseen by the Department of Human Services, that recognizes daycare providers who go the extra mile in offering exceptional care. The award system grants a 1-Star rating (lowest) up to a 5-Star rating (highest).

To receive a QRS Level 1 rating a childcare center or preschool must meet Iowa’s licensing standards and procedures. A QRS Level 2 rating requires the center to participate in the Child and Adult Care Food Program, provide orientation for new employees, ask employees to complete a self-assessment annually, and complete a center self-assessment annually.

For the QRS Level 3, 4, and 5 ratings, centers must meet the requirement in levels 1 & 2 plus have made significant steps in meeting key indicators of quality in the areas of Professional Development, Health and Safety, Environment, Family and Community Partnerships, and Leadership & Administration. Points are awarded in these five categories to determine the rating earned. The requirements for the higher rating levels get tougher as the rating level goes up.

The center participates in the CACFP (Child and Adult Care Food Program) requiring proper serving sizes, whole grain rich foods, limits on sugar, and only 100% juice served. It is a non-pricing center, which means there isn’t a separate charge for well balanced meals (breakfast & lunch) and the two snacks that are served.

All staff meets, and in most cases exceeds, the Iowa Department of Human Service’s requirements for trainings in Mandatory Reporting, Universal Precautions, Essentials Child Care and DHS approved certification in First Aid and CPR. The staff is also required to complete annual trainings above these requirements and under Iowa Code, Section 232.69, are required to report any suspected child abuse or neglect.
